I'll overwhelm 'legitimate combatant' Jake Paul - Joshua

Anthony Joshua and Jake Paul face-off

The British boxer is set to fight the American YouTuber in an eight round contest which will be shown in real-time on Netflix.

Briton Joshua stated he will "stamp all over" the American and "overpower" the American as the pair met personally to publicize next month's bout.

Ex two time world boxing king Anthony Joshua meets social media star turned fighter Paul - in what is, by the numbers, a mammoth uneven pairing - at Miami's Kaseya Center on December 19th.

Boxer's Attitude

"I will damage his features and hurt his body. I'm here to prove my superiority," the British boxer, 35 years old, said.

"I plan to overwhelm him. That's a fighter's mentality.

"I'm going to seriously aim to cause him pain. That's what I want to do."

Targeting Fury

Anthony Joshua, at the same time, criticized UK opponent Tyson Fury - and declined a £1m bet 'The Gypsy King' says he will place on a victory for Paul.

"[Paul] is better than Tyson Fury - he's actually sitting here," Joshua commented.

"I respect him for that."

Jake Paul's Background

Jake Paul - who initially became famous on the television network - has mainly boxed mixed martial artists or past-their-prime fighters since becoming pro.

He was defeated by British fighter Tommy Fury in last year.

Commercial Success

Nevertheless, the relative newcomer continues to be one of boxing's biggest financial successes, consistently making massive earnings.

Prediction and Belief

The 28-year-old anticipated a stoppage in the fourth or fifth round and stated he would prevent the much-anticipated Fury-Joshua bout, which is allegedly under discussion for two years from now.

"The next fight will be myself against Tyson Fury in the coming year," Paul stated.
